diff options
author | Miguel Ojeda <ojeda@kernel.org> | 2022-08-04 12:54:09 +0200 |
---|---|---|
committer | Miguel Ojeda <ojeda@kernel.org> | 2022-09-28 09:02:20 +0200 |
commit | 80db40bac8f42f23132b2898b0490f8f76868a57 (patch) | |
tree | 2dab5cc87007a7bd37d63772c50d7dbedac05cae | |
parent | scripts: add `is_rust_module.sh` (diff) | |
download | linux-80db40bac8f42f23132b2898b0490f8f76868a57.tar.xz linux-80db40bac8f42f23132b2898b0490f8f76868a57.zip |
rust: add `.rustfmt.toml`
This is the configuration file for the `rustfmt` tool.
`rustfmt` is a tool for formatting Rust code according to style guidelines.
It is very commonly used across Rust projects.
The default configuration options are used.
Reviewed-by: Kees Cook <keescook@chromium.org>
Co-developed-by: Alex Gaynor <alex.gaynor@gmail.com>
Signed-off-by: Alex Gaynor <alex.gaynor@gmail.com>
Co-developed-by: Wedson Almeida Filho <wedsonaf@google.com>
Signed-off-by: Wedson Almeida Filho <wedsonaf@google.com>
Signed-off-by: Miguel Ojeda <ojeda@kernel.org>
-rw-r--r-- | .gitignore | 1 | ||||
-rw-r--r-- | .rustfmt.toml | 12 |
2 files changed, 13 insertions, 0 deletions
diff --git a/.gitignore b/.gitignore index 80989914c97d..97e085d613a2 100644 --- a/.gitignore +++ b/.gitignore @@ -97,6 +97,7 @@ modules.order !.gitattributes !.gitignore !.mailmap +!.rustfmt.toml # # Generated include files diff --git a/.rustfmt.toml b/.rustfmt.toml new file mode 100644 index 000000000000..3de5cc497465 --- /dev/null +++ b/.rustfmt.toml @@ -0,0 +1,12 @@ +edition = "2021" +newline_style = "Unix" + +# Unstable options that help catching some mistakes in formatting and that we may want to enable +# when they become stable. +# +# They are kept here since they are useful to run from time to time. +#format_code_in_doc_comments = true +#reorder_impl_items = true +#comment_width = 100 +#wrap_comments = true +#normalize_comments = true |